    An idea for using up the haircare vouchers is to make up gift bags with a few items from within the same range. So far i have made up 2 frizz-ease, 1 lee stafford and 1 brilliant brunette. The frizz-ease is the cheapest/easiest to make up as many items in the range cost £3.xx and they seem to have the biggest assortment of products to choose from.
    Most people get too many bodycare gifts so these will make a nice change.
    Wine gift bags are perfect to give them in as some of the products are too tall for standard gift bags.

    EG
    FRIZZ EASE
    shampoo £4.48
    conditioner £4.28
    hairspray £3.59
    wind down creme £3.79
    serum £3.30
    5 minute manager £3.59
    mousse £3.65

    Should cost £26.68, actually costs £5.68 with 7 of the £3 vouchers
